Creating content for your audience is one of the most important things you can do to increase your online reputation and personal brand. But it can be hard to come up with new content on a regular basis. Social Listening is an important part of maintaining and improving your brand. It is important that you listen to what is happening in your industry (and related industries). You want to know what other people are talking about and what is important to your audience. With this information, you are able to share your perspective on current events or news.

Explore Feedly.com to understand how to set up feeds that can provide you a constant flow of information from the sources you trust. Feedly.com is a news/content aggregator that will bring in all the information from different sites, news sources, blogs, etc. for you to choose from as you are thinking of creating new content for your audience. Why Social Listening Matters:
Hootsuite’s article “What is Social Listening, Why it Matters, and 10 Tools to Make it Easier” sheds light on how social media thrives on active listening. By paying attention to industry trends and audience preferences gleaned from various platforms, you can tailor your content to resonate deeply. This targeted approach fosters stronger engagement and brand loyalty.
